Team Synopsis: New York Yankees

The New York Yankees, often referred to simply as the Yankees, are one of the most storied franchises in Major League Baseball (MLB). Founded in 1901, the team is based in the Bronx, New York City, and has a rich history filled with success, including a record 27 World Series championships. The Yankees are known for their iconic pinstriped uniforms and legendary players, such as Babe Ruth, Lou Gehrig, Joe DiMaggio, Mickey Mantle, and Derek Jeter. They play their home games at Yankee Stadium, which is seen as a cathedral of baseball.

Interesting Factoid: The Yankees have a long-standing rivalry with the Boston Red Sox, known as one of the greatest rivalries in sports history. This rivalry intensified in 1919 when the Yankees acquired Babe Ruth from the Red Sox, a move that many believe cursed Boston for decades.

Less Known Fact: Despite their dominance, the Yankees have faced significant challenges in certain eras. Notably, from 1981 to 1995, they experienced a playoff drought of 14 years, marking the longest absence from postseason play in franchise history.

Performance Analysis (March - August 2025)

The Yankees began the 2025 season with a promising start, winning four of their first six games against the Milwaukee Brewers. However, their performance fluctuated throughout the season, showing strong offensive capabilities, particularly in games against teams like the Milwaukee Brewers and Pittsburgh Pirates, where they scored as many as 20 runs in a single game.

Despite these high-scoring games, the Yankees encountered difficulties against various opponents, notably the Arizona Diamondbacks and the Tampa Bay Rays, where they lost several close matchups. A notable trend is their struggle against division rivals, which resulted in multiple consecutive losses, particularly in late June and early July against teams like the Toronto Blue Jays.

As the season progressed, the Yankees showcased resilience, winning games against strong teams like the Seattle Mariners and the Chicago Cubs, but their inconsistency remained a hallmark of their performance. They had a mix of high-scoring victories and disappointing losses, particularly in series against the Philadelphia Phillies and Miami Marlins.

Overall, the Yankees' performance in the first half of the 2025 season demonstrated their potential and offensive prowess, but also highlighted areas for improvement, particularly in pitching consistency and performance against rival teams.
